Just weeks after finding themselves at the center of a cultural appropriation controversy, rookie girl group KISS OF LIFE is seemingly struggling to regain public attention.

The group’s alleged drop in popularity has become a hot topic among K-Pop fans online, with many expressing shock at how much has changed in such a short time.

kiss of life billboard| Billboard

In early April, KISS OF LIFE sparked backlash during a livestream held for member Julie’s birthday. The group dressed in what they described as “old-school hip hop” style — wearing oversized chains, hats, and sporting hairstyles like cornrows and Bantu knots. Their exaggerated mannerisms and choice of styling were widely criticized for reinforcing harmful stereotypes of Black culture. The livestream led to mass complaints from international fans, and S2 Entertainment later issued a public apology.

Following the controversy, netizens claim their interest in the group noticeably declined. While KISS OF LIFE had been gaining momentum as one of the rising rookie groups known for strong performances and social media engagement, the scandal seems to have caused a major setback. Fans have pointed out that fewer people are actively following the group’s activities since the incident.

On May 7, KISS OF LIFE released a digital single titled KISS ROAD with the track “Live Laugh Love.” However, unlike their earlier releases, this comeback failed to generate buzz. The animated music video has only reached 1.4 million views, low for a group that once enjoyed viral attention.

The song was released with little to no pre-promotion, which some fans described as a “surprise” drop. Despite that, the group is currently promoting the track, including a live performance posted on the popular YouTube channel it’sLive. Unfortunately, the clip only gained attention on X (formerly Twitter) due to viewers mocking the song rather than celebrating it.

Many fans were stunned to realize a group that previously benefited so heavily from K-Pop’s social media-driven success could release a song without anyone noticing.
